Output 93a88b83b5c79f8758415020b53ff766f1024bf9c209dbff6a0de955c6c32d7b:0

value
342702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b73a13cce3113066c5dd1812dc3f8c10d7c45a OP_EQUAL
address
3JM8QHM2MYCtYaLwSMua4BKvgAu9nP6MA2
transaction
93a88b83b5c79f8758415020b53ff766f1024bf9c209dbff6a0de955c6c32d7b
spent
true